I have just gotten a huge new shipment of gorgeous blue topaz,
citrine, peridot, garnet, and ruby beads, mostly briolettes. I have a
couple of questions for hobbyists who buy or sell gemstone beads
online.

1) do you have better luck shopping or selling on ebay, justbeads,
etsy, or someplace else?

2) Do you prefer lots of all the same beads, or small mixed lots? I
think it would be awesome to sell a briolette lot with several of each
different type that I have. But would it sell?

Thats always the big question, isn't it? I find things do better for
me as a seller on Etsy than ebay, and 20 cents for a listing that
lasts for 4 months is a very good gamble, as opposed to the fees on
ebay for a week's auction. My vote is try it a couple of different
ways on Etsy and if they dont sell, you are out less than a dollar.
